Advanced Telephone Management Features
Current phone systems should provide advanced call handling capabilities which enhance the user experience and enhance business efficiency. One crucial feature is the ability to customize call routing. This enables organizations to route calls to the suitable departments or team members according to specific criteria, such as caller location, time of day, or even the nature of the inquiry. By using intelligent call routing, businesses can make sure that their customers consistently reach the right person quickly, reducing wait times and enhancing satisfaction.
Another significant feature is the integration of call analytics. This functionality provides valuable insights into call patterns, duration, and outcomes, allowing businesses to assess their communication strategies. By reviewing these metrics, organizations can identify areas for improvement, understand peak calling times, and even improve employee performance. This data-driven approach enables companies to make data-backed decisions that can lead to a more efficient phone system overall.
Moreover, modern phone systems should include advanced voicemail management options. Strong Protection Measures
In the modern digital landscape, the security of phone systems has become more essential. Modern phone systems need to integrate sophisticated security measures to defend sensitive communication from various threats. This comprises encryption protocols that safeguard data in transit, ensuring that conversations won't be intercepted by illegitimate entities. Additionally, features like protected login processes help to sustain user integrity and prevent unauthorized access to the system.
Another crucial aspect of protection in telephone systems is the execution of regular software updates and patches. Maintaining the system up to speed minimizes vulnerabilities that could be taken advantage of by hackers. A proactive approach to safety means that the phone system can adapt to emerging threats, thus providing ongoing protection for both the organization and its users. Breach detection systems can also be beneficial, as they observe for suspicious activity and instantly alert administrators to potential breaches.
Lastly, user training takes a significant role in upholding the safety of a phone system. Employees must be educated on best practices, such as spotting phishing attempts and grasping the value of strong passwords. By fostering a environment of awareness and accountability, organizations can boost their phone system's security. Merging technology with knowledgeable users creates a more strong communication environment that can withstand various cyber threats.
